does wubi delete your parition?!?!?!

i have just started the install on to my o:\ drive which holds all my ghost image back up files , but wubi is installing 46 % , pls can someone advise me
 
No. It installs as a file in your windows partition. You can add/remove it via add/remove programs within windows.

That said, performance is a bit slower than if it had its own dedicated partition.

Also, if you're interested, Linux Mint 6 has Mint4Win now (same as Wubi)
